Retailing: Shuffling the Lazari

Looking forward to his 83rd birth day next month — and backward on a 65-year career in merchandising — the chairman of the U.S.'s largest depart ment store group announced last week that he was relinquishing his title. Fred Lazarus Jr. turned full command over to Son Ralph, 53, and will keep only the honorary assignment of executive committee chairman of Federated Department Stores Inc.
